Strengthening research capacity of governmental officials
Training on Research Methodologies, Labour Market Analysis and Forecasting Method

The Hanns Seidel Foundation in Vietnam (HSF) joined hand with the Institute of Labour Science and Social Affairs (ILSSA) to organize a two-day training workshop on research methodologies and labour market forecasting. The training aims to strengthen research capacity for young researchers and officials of government agencies regarding labour science.

The training course was held at the Institute of Labour and Social Sciences for 2 days. The participants listened to the sharing from labour experts, lecturers, researchers from several universities, research institutes and governmental agencies, including: Vietnam General Confederation of Labour, Department of Employment, Department of Labour Relations and Wage, Department of Legal Affairs, National Centre for Employment Services, Hanoi Employment Service Centre, University of Economics National Economics, University of Social Sciences and Humanities, University of Labour and Social Affairs.

During this two-day training, researchers and junior staff received training on qualitative and quantitative methodologies, as well as approaches when analysing the Vietnamese labour market. The concepts of information extraction, suitable data processing, and data use based on analysis models were also covered. Additionally, the training course covered some of the 2019 Labour Code's new sections, which are crucial to updating the Labour Code with the latest information. Through the lectures, training participants were kept up to date on pertinent information, knowledge, and documents for scientific study, instruction, consultation, and government policy making. ILSSA developed and strengthened a network for specialists, researchers, and lecturers to share knowledge and experiences, which helped the training course succeed.

For the last 10 years, HSF has been closely collaborating with the ILSSA on conducting empirical research, training courses and consultation workshops on emerging and sizzling social issues in Vietnam in a timely manner. This longstanding partnership is part of HSF’s efforts to fulfil our commitment to supporting just, equitable and sustainable social development in Vietnam.
